Edison comes with all of these free online resources…10 robotics lesson plansIntegrate Edison into your classroom with ease with our fully illustrated set of 10 free robotics lesson plans. The complete document is 66 pages and includes 36 student Worksheets, 5 Activity sheets, a student achievement chart and a student award certificate.Your EdVenture into Robotics - You're a ControllerIn EdBook1 learn about robotics with Edison, no programming required! Edison can read special barcodes in the book that activate pre-programmed features, such as line following, obstacle avoidance, sumo wrestling and much more. In total seven fun and educational robot activities across 16 pages.Robot activity matAn A1 size (23in x 33in) mat for robot activities such as line following and bounce in borders. The EdMat has six barcodes that activate pre-installed programs such as follow torch, line tracking and sumo wrestle. The EdMat can be downloaded for free and printed at your local print shop.Your EdVenture into Robotics - You're a ProgrammerIn EdBook2 learn about robot programming by programming Edison yourself!




Learn how to write your own robot programs using EdWare’s easy to use drag and drop graphical robot programming software. In total 10 fun and educational robot activities across 27 pages.Graphical robot programming softwareMake robot programming fun and easy to learn with drag and drop graphical icons. EdWare is FREE to use and is for Windows, Mac, Linux, iOS (iPad) and Android tablets. Your EdVenture into Robotics - You're a BuilderIn EdBook3 learn about adding pieces made by LEGO to your Edison robot.
